A geometric sans built from rounded-rectangle and superellipse shapes, with consistent stroke thickness and generously radiused corners. Curves tend to square off into softened flats, giving bowls and counters a rectangular rhythm rather than circular. Terminals are clean and often horizontal or vertical, and joins stay controlled and minimal, producing a sturdy, engineered texture. Spacing reads even and stable in text, with compact apertures and a slightly boxy silhouette across both uppercase and lowercase.

This style is well suited to display settings where a strong, contemporary presence is needed—headlines, logos, and product branding—especially in tech, gaming, and industrial contexts. It can also work for UI labels and signage where a compact, sturdy shape language helps maintain legibility and consistency.

The overall tone feels modern and technical, like interface lettering designed to look precise and robust. Rounded corners soften the voice, keeping it approachable while still projecting strength and efficiency. Its squared curves add a subtly futuristic flavor without becoming overtly decorative.

The design appears intended to translate a rounded-rectangular, screen-native geometry into a versatile sans that feels systematic and modern. By maintaining uniform stroke behavior and softened corners, it aims for a blend of durability, clarity, and a friendly technological character.

Distinctive superelliptical bowls (notably in rounded letters and numerals) create a consistent, modular system. The forms favor clarity over calligraphic nuance, and the broad, rounded structure keeps headings cohesive and impactful at larger sizes.
